#49D822 Color
#49D822 is rgb(73, 216, 34) in RGB, hsl(107, 73%, 49%) in HSL, and about cmyk(66%, 0%, 84%, 15%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is SGBUS Green (#55DD33),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.56.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#49D822 Channel Values
How #49D822 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 73 · G 216 · B 34 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 107° · S 73% · L 49%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 107° · S 84% · V 85%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 66% · M 0% · Y 84% · K 15%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.89:1 vs white · 11.13: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#49D822 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#49D822?
#49D822 is a mid-tone green — rgb(73, 216, 34) in RGB and hsl(107, 73%, 49%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is SGBUS Green (#55DD33),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.56.
What is the RGB value of #49D822?
#49D822 is rgb(73, 216, 34) — red 73, green 216, and blue 34 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#49D822?
#49D822 converts to approximately cmyk(66%, 0%, 84%, 15%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#49D822 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#49D822 scores 1.89:1 against white and 11.13: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#49D822 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#49D822 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is limegreen (#32CD32) at a CIE76 distance of 8.92,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
